Statistics
| Branch: | Tag: | Revision:

root / cloudcms / templates / cms / base.html @ cccf9d14

History | View | Annotate | Download (4.9 kB)

1
<!doctype html>
2
{% load feincms_tags feincms_page_tags %}
3

    
4
<head>
5
  <title>
6
      {% block page.title %}{% if feincms_page.page_title %}{{ feincms_page.page_title }}
7
      {% else %}{{ feincms_page.title }}{% endif %} | {{ APP.title }}{% endblock %}
8
  </title>
9
  <meta http-equiv="X-UA-Compatible" content="IE=edge,chrome=1">
10
  <meta name="viewport" content="width=device-width, initial-scale=1.0,minimum-scale=1.0, maximum-scale=1.0">  
11
  
12
  {% block favicons %}
13
  <link rel="shortcut icon" href="{{ APP.favicon.get_absolute_url }}">
14
  <link rel="apple-touch-icon" href="{{ APP.favicon.get_absolute_url }}">
15
  {% endblock favicons %}
16

    
17
  {% block css %}
18
      <link href='https://fonts.googleapis.com/css?family=Didact+Gothic&subset=latin' rel='stylesheet' type='text/css'>
19
      <link rel="stylesheet" type="text/css" href="{{ MEDIA_URL }}cloudcms/css/global.css">
20
      <link rel="stylesheet" type="text/css" href="{{ MEDIA_URL }}cloudcms/css/print.css" media="print">
21
      <!--[if lte IE 7]>
22
          <link rel="stylesheet" type="text/css" href="{{ MEDIA_URL }}cloudcms/css/ie7.css">
23
      <![endif]-->
24
      <link rel="stylesheet" media="screen and (max-width: 960px)" href="{{ MEDIA_URL }}cloudcms/css/max960.css"/>
25
      <link rel="stylesheet" media="screen and (max-width: 768px)" href="{{ MEDIA_URL }}cloudcms/css/max768.css"/>
26
      <link rel="stylesheet" media="screen and (max-width: 480px)" href="{{ MEDIA_URL }}cloudcms/css/max480.css"/>  
27
  {% endblock css %}
28

    
29
  {% block headjs %}
30
      <script src="{{ MEDIA_URL }}cloudcms/js/jquery-1.7.1.min.js"></script>
31
      <script src="{{ MEDIA_URL }}cloudcms/js/underscore.js"></script>
32
      <script src="{{ MEDIA_URL }}cloudcms/js/jquery.infieldlabel.js"></script>
33
      <script src="{{ MEDIA_URL }}cloudcms/js/jquery.colorbox.js"></script>
34
      <script src="{{ MEDIA_URL }}cloudcms/js/jquery.dropkick-1.0.0.js"></script>
35
      <script src="{{ MEDIA_URL }}cloudcms/js/common.js"></script>
36
      <script src="{{ MEDIA_URL }}cloudcms/js/forms.js"></script>
37
      <script src="{{ MEDIA_URL }}cloudcms/js/os.js"></script>
38
      <script src="{{ MEDIA_URL }}cloudcms/js/resources_list.js"></script> 
39
  {% endblock headjs %}
40

    
41
  {% block page.cms.media %}
42
  {{ feincms_page.content.media }}
43
  {% endblock %}
44

    
45
  {% block page.scripts.cloudbar %}
46
      {% if CLOUDBAR_ACTIVE %} {{ CLOUDBAR_CODE }} {% endif %}
47
  {% endblock %}
48

    
49
   <script type="text/javascript">
50
      $(document).ready(function() {
51
          $("form.innerlabels label").inFieldLabels();
52
          $("form .form-row").formErrors();
53
      })
54
   </script>
55
  {% block endhead %}{% endblock endhead %}
56

    
57
  <style type="text/css">
58
  {% block extrastyles %}
59
  {% endblock %}
60
  </style>
61

    
62
  {% if APP.extra_styles %}
63
  <style type="text/css">
64
      {{ APP.extra_styles|safe }}
65
  </style>
66
  {% endif %}
67
    
68
</head>
69

    
70
<body>
71
    {% block page.mainbody %}
72
     
73
    <div class="container">
74
            <div class="wrapper">
75
                <div class="mainlogo">
76
                        {% if APP.logo %}
77
                                <h1>
78
                                    <a href="{{ APP.index_url }}" title="{{ APP.title }}">
79
                                        <img src="{{ APP.logo.get_absolute_url }}" alt="{{ APP.title }}" />
80
                                    </a>
81
                                </h1>
82
                        {% else %}
83
                            <h1>{{ APP.title }}</h1>
84
                        {% endif %}
85
                    </div>
86
                <div class="navigation">
87
                    <ul>
88
                        {% block page.nav %}
89
                            {% feincms_navigation of feincms_page as sublevel level=2,depth=1 %}
90
                            {% for p in sublevel %}
91
                            <li class="{% if p|is_equal_or_parent_of:feincms_page %}active{% endif %}">
92
                            <a href="{{ p.get_absolute_url }}">{{ p.title }}</a></li>
93
                            {% endfor %}
94
                        {% endblock %}
95
                    </ul>
96
                    <ul>
97
                        {% block page.subnav %}
98
                            {% if feincms_page.override_url != "/" %}
99
                            {% feincms_navigation of feincms_page as sublevel level=3,depth=1 %}
100
                            {% for p in sublevel %}
101
                            <li class="{% if p|is_equal_or_parent_of:feincms_page or p.url == request.path %}active{% endif %}">
102
                            <a href="{{ p.get_absolute_url }}">{{ p.title }}</a></li>
103
                            {% endfor %}
104
                            {% endif %}
105
                        {% endblock %}
106
                    </ul>
107
                </div>
108
                <div class="content">
109
                    {% block page.body %}
110
                    {% endblock %}
111
                    </div>
112
            </div>    
113
    </div>
114
    {% if messages %}
115
    <ul class="messages">
116
        {% for message in messages %}
117
        <li{% if  %}
118
            class="{{ message.tags }}"{% endif %}>
119
            {{ message }}</li>
120
        {% endfor %}
121
    </ul>
122
    {% endif %}
123
    
124
    
125
    <div class="footer">
126
        <div class="wrapper">
127
                {% include "cms/footer.html" %}
128
        </div>
129
    </div>
130
    {% endblock page.mainbody %}
131
</body>
132
</html>